Output 4cfba55901fc6841ab13cccc80bfdc412c1814e5e2102edfefb58bbe2f3a72da:4

value
19105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e5c4a1f47c8f66b7010aefdc442fc88c09c3492 OP_EQUAL
address
38qMBtvxvFWoEPiVN6nq73cDkXFSzV1gyA
transaction
4cfba55901fc6841ab13cccc80bfdc412c1814e5e2102edfefb58bbe2f3a72da
confirmations
287201
spent
true